To make a call

You can make and receive calls only when the phone is switched on, the
communicator has a valid SIM card fitted, and it is located in the service area
of the cellular network.
Note: In some networks emergency calls to
the international emergency number 112
may be made without a SIM card. Check with
your network operator. For more information
about making emergency calls, see
"Emergency calls" on page 175.
1 Key in the area code and the phone number of the person you wish to call.
If you make a mistake, you can remove the digits one at a time by pressing
Clear repeatedly, or clear the whole display by pressing and holding Clear.
For international calls, start by pressing
international call character + appears on the display, which informs the
network centre to select the country-specific international prefix. Enter
the country code, area code and the phone number.
2 Press
to dial the phone number.
3 When the phone number disappears and the text Call 1 is shown, the call is
connected.
